Computational Methods in Mass Spectrometry-Based Proteomics

Adv Exp Med Biol. 2016:939:63-89. doi: 10.1007/978-981-10-1503-8_4.

Abstract

This chapter introduces computational methods used in mass spectrometry-based proteomics, including those for addressing the critical problems such as peptide identification and protein inference, peptide and protein quantification, characterization of posttranslational modifications (PTMs), and data-independent acquisitions (DIA). The chapter concludes with emerging applications of proteomic techniques, such as metaproteomics, glycoproteomics, and proteogenomics.
